Haw. Code R. § 11-800-45 - Grievance
The community care foster family home shall have policies and procedures by and through which a client may present grievances about the operation or services of the home. The policies shall include a provision that a client may choose to present any grievance directly to the department of health. The home shall:
(1) Inform the
client or the client's legal representative of the grievance policies and
procedures and the right to appeal in a grievance situation;
(2) Provide a written copy of the grievance
policies and procedures to the client or the client's legal representative,
which includes the names and telephone numbers of the individuals who shall be
contacted in order to report a grievance; and
(3) Obtain signed acknowledgments from the
client or the client's legal representative that the grievance policies and
procedures were reviewed.
